Bremsstrahlung X-rays were observed by the Polar Patrol Balloon No. 6(PPB #6) launched from Antarctic Syowa Station in January 1993. X-ray data of 1 s time resolution was available in the period of 0855 UT (0914 MLT) to 1630 UT (1614 MLT) on January 5, when the balloon was located within the real-time telemetry range of Syowa Station. Temporal variations of X-rays in the energy range of 30-120 keV were compared with ground-based data of magnetic pulsations, VLF emissions and CNA at 30 MHz observed at Syowa Station and at Tjornes in Iceland, the geomagnetic conjugate point of Syowa in the Antarctic.
